Instructions
Preparation Steps
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Cook manicotti shells according to package instructions; drain and set aside.
In a large mixing bowl, combine shredded chicken, ricotta, mozzarella, parmesan, spinach, artichoke hearts, minced garlic, salt, and pepper. Mix well.
Stuff each manicotti shell with the mixture and place in a greased baking dish.
Pour marinara sauce over the top of the manicotti shells.
Cover the dish with foil and bake for 30 minutes. Remove foil and bake for an additional 15 minutes until golden and bubbly.
Allow to cool for 5 minutes before serving.
Notes
For best results, let the dish sit for a few minutes after baking to absorb any extra sauce. Serve with a side salad and some crusty bread.
